    Dr Siddharth Sridhar‏Verified account @sid8998 1 Apr 2021

    More good news for the Pfizer/ BioNTech vaccine: 1. Protection against symptomatic COVID-19 of 91.3% even 6 months after the second dose 2. No COVID-19 cases in the vaccine group of a South African trial so far suggesting efficacy against the B.1.351 variant

      1. Dr Siddharth Sridhar‏Verified account @sid8998 1 Apr 2021

        Although caveat to the second point is that only 9 COVID-19 cases have been recorded in the SA trial, which has only enrolled 800 participants. Early days and a pinch of salt, but promising nevertheless... https://www.pfizer.com/news/press-release/press-release-detail/pfizer-and-biontech-confirm-high-efficacy-and-no-serious …
